Transaction 896a8d239374558483f76e1729eb3b634a6405866275d3dd28f8a8053d93d4c9
1 Input
1 Output
-
896a8d239374558483f76e1729eb3b634a6405866275d3dd28f8a8053d93d4c9:0
- value
- 268405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64593512e2123c431afe9f77dba87a765aae4ed4 OP_EQUAL
- address
- 3AqcMxdiuGevrnCyJz8YjfTGcEgaoUJiAF